.Boom! Boom! Boom!
Is the sound of the bombs,
Destructive echoes from metalic stumps.
It kills the young.
It kills the old.
With a ravaging sound,
That rises from the ground.
From the evil man's indurate heart,
That is always cold.
With unremorseful force,
It pierces our loved ones.
Leaving us with havoc,
Bloodshed and tears in our eyes.
This cruel incessant
Reverberating sound,
Boom! Boom! Boom!

THE TWO CHILDREN
The two children,
Of empyreal and mundane Inclinations.
Addicted to their preoccupations.
One hating iniquity.
The other, chastity.
The mundane child,
Eternity he has forgotten.
The empyreal child, in
Posterity always awaken.
One steadfast in spirituality
The other diligent in canality.
O thee mundane child,
What will thee tell posterity?
That thee squandered thy life in
Frivolity?
Ah! it is abysmal.
You empyreal child,
You must not forget,
Posterity also await your
Fecundity.
I beseech thee,
Entangle not thyself,
With the mundane's child
Barbarity.

God made us friends for a reason,
May we last all season.
Even when times are bad,
And our friendship seems to tide,
I will stick to you and abide.
Two hearts that beat as one,
Indeed May we become.
As time pass and ages run,
Rosy friends we shall be.
In cold and rainy days,
Cozy friends we shall be.
As the bliss of friendship tarries,
Together we shall be.
From your wondrous companion,
Friend forever.
